What does an assistant tech do?

An Assistant Tech, short for Assistant Technician, supports senior technicians and engineers by performing routine maintenance, troubleshooting, and repairs on equipment or systems. Their duties often include preparing tools, following instructions for installations or upgrades, and documenting work completed. Assistant Techs play a crucial role in ensuring operations run smoothly by assisting with both preventative and corrective maintenance tasks. This role is common in industries such as healthcare, IT, manufacturing, and automotive. They typically work under supervision, gaining valuable hands-on experience to advance their technical sk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ant tech?

To thrive as an Assistant Tech, you need a basic understanding of technical procedures, troubleshooting abilities, and often a high school diploma or relevant certification. Familiarity with common diagnostic tools, maintenance software, and industry-specific equipment is typically required. Strong attention to detail, communication skills, and the ability to follow instructions make candidates stand out in this support role. These skills ensure efficient technical support, minimize downtime, and contribute to the smooth operation of technical environments.

What are the most common challenges faced by assistant techs in a fast-paced work environment?

Assistant Techs often encounter challenges such as managing multiple tasks simultaneously, adapting quickly to new technologies, and maintaining strong attention to detail while under time constraints. In busy settings, it's essential to communicate effectively with team members, prioritize tasks, and remain organized to ensure all technical support duties are completed efficiently. Developing good time-management skills and staying proactive in resolving issues can help Assistant Techs thrive in fast-paced environments.

How do I become a assistant tech?

To become an assistant tech, you typ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, along with basic technical knowledge. Relevant skills include troubleshooting, hardware and software support, and familiarity with tools like diagnostic software; certifications such as CompTIA A+ can also improve job prospects. Gaining experience through internships or entry-level positions helps build practical skills in technical support environments.

What is the job of a assistant tech?

An assistant tech provides technical support by troubleshooting hardware and software issues, setting up equipment, and assisting with network or system maintenance. They often work under the supervision of IT professionals and may need basic certifications or knowledge of common tools and systems.

About Ogden Clinic

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

Ogden Clinic is a leading healthcare provider based in Ogden, Utah, USA. Operating in the medical industry, the clinic offers a comprehensive range of healthcare services including primary care, specialty care, and urgent care services. Founded in 1950, Ogden Clinic has grown to become one of the most trusted healthcare providers in the region, boasting a network of over 20 locations and more than 150 healthcare providers. The clinic is committed to improving community health, guided by its core values of integrity, collaboration, excellence, and compassion. Their mission is to provide superior and personalized healthcare, changing lives for the better.
